Tyrolia Attack LYT 11 Ski Bindings 2026
Tyrolia ATTACK LYT 11 GW Ski Bindings
Light, compact, all-mountain bindings with easy step-in and full GripWalk compatibility.
Lightweight Power, All-Mountain Reliability
- FR LYT Toe (~15% lighter): Trims swing weight while maintaining security and precise boot centering.
- Auto Toe-Height Adjustment: Seamlessly adapts to Alpine DIN (ISO 5355 A) and GripWalk (ISO 23223 A) soles.
- SX FR / NX FR Heel: Smooth, confidence-boosting step-in with consistent, predictable release.
- Low, Stable Stance: 17 mm stack height for better snow feel and strong edge power.
- Wide Platform, Slim Build: Drives modern skis without extra bulk or weight.
Perfect For
Progressing to advanced skiers who want a light, no-fuss binding for daily all-mountain laps—groomers, bumps, trees, and the occasional side hit.
The Details
- DIN Range: 3–11
- Stand Height: 17 mm
- Weight: ~905 g per binding (approx.)
- Toe: FR LYT (auto height, improved boot centering)
- Heel: SX FR / NX FR (easy step-in)
- Boot Compatibility: Alpine DIN (ISO 5355 A), GripWalk (ISO 23223 A)
- Brake Options: 95 mm, 110 mm
- Use: All-Mountain / Freeski
Bottom Line
Attack LYT 11 GW packs everyday durability and modern ski-driving power into a lighter, compact chassis—set it and rip it.

About Head
Advanced Performance for the Dedicated Athlete
HEAD, established in 1950, is a renowned global manufacturer of premium sports equipment and apparel. The company operates across five divisions: Winter Sports, Racquet Sports, Water Sports, Sportswear, and Licensing. Known for pioneering innovations such as oversized tennis rackets and utilizing cutting-edge materials, HEAD supports top-tier athletes including Novak Djokovic and Alexander Zverev. The brand is dedicated to promoting an active lifestyle and sustainability, integrating eco-friendly practices into their production processes. HEAD’s commitment to performance and quality makes them a leader in the sports equipment industry.
